I've been tuning my rig for power efficiency so I thought I'd share some results...
This chip will run daily stable ~5Ghz and bench ~5.3, but it takes a lot of v's and becomes very inefficient!
For daily use I've settled for the following clocks (IMC voltage is 1.275):
Just for reference, this is my main rig, it's water cooled and loaded for bear!
Here are some specs so you folks know what else is sucking power:
Five/120mm fans for the rads
Two/ 140mm fans for the case/HD cage
OCZ Mem cooler fans over the PWM heatsink
Aftermarket Zalman dual fan cooler for the 6870 vid card
MPC35X Pump and a C5F 990FX mobo.
With CnQ enabled here is my idle draw:
Here's the draw while running the WinRAR benchmark (represents max real world use, including WCG & encoding video):
And finally, the power draw while running P95 Blend as shown in the 1st SS:
Someone over in Xtreme News said the 8350 drew 200w by itself when OC'd...
That may be true when pushing the ABSOLUTE limits, but with a little tuning the 8350 isn't all that bad!![]()
